PCP* (looking at the cardiologist’s reports): Oh, yeah, this needs to be fixed.

We then had a nice long discussion about surgeons and what I had done so far.

PCP: If you’re going to ask things like that, they’re going to have to see your face, and you’re going to have to ask in a way that they don’t perceive as questioning their competence.

What you have is pretty rare. You’re probably not going to find a surgeon outside of a tertiary care facility who does more than a few of these a year.

*PCP: Primary Care Physician

Advice from my sister: Don’t you know someone who works in one of the hospital OR’s or ICU units? Ask them who they would use, or who they’d avoid.

Me: Well, I know an anesthetist who works at a different hospital.

Sister: Ask him. They share information.

Me (during a discussion with my dad): I found a cardiac surgeon who was at the same hospital you were in 40 years ago…

Dad (recognizing the name): Yes! I remember him! I bet if I called him he could give me some good names!

What do people do when they don’t know anyone in the medical field?
